Topics Covered
- 1. Introduction to Static Code Analysis: Learners will understand the basics of static code analysis, its importance, and how it differs from dynamic testing. They will gain foundational skills in identifying common code issues and the terminology used in the field.
- 2. Static Code Analysis Tools: This module covers the selection and use of various static code analysis tools, including their features and limitations. Learners will be able to choose and configure tools effectively for different development environments.
- 3. Common Programming Errors and Their Analysis: Learners will study common programming errors such as null pointer exceptions, buffer overflows, and logical errors, and how to use static analysis to detect and prevent them.
- 4. Advanced Static Analysis Techniques: This module delves into more sophisticated techniques like taint analysis, data flow analysis, and constraint solving. Learners will learn to apply these techniques to improve code quality and security.
- 5. Integration of Static Analysis into CI/CD Pipelines: Learners will explore how to integrate static code analysis into continuous integration and continuous deployment pipelines, ensuring that code quality checks are a part of the development process.
- 6. Static Analysis for Security: This module focuses on using static code analysis to identify security vulnerabilities, such as SQL injection and cross-site scripting (XSS). Learners will learn how to write secure code and use tools to detect these issues.
- 7. Performance Analysis with Static Code Analysis: Learners will study how to use static code analysis to optimize code performance, including identifying bottlenecks and inefficient algorithms. They will learn practical techniques for improving code efficiency.
